A book with 300,000 words, how long would an ordinary person take to finish reading it?

A book with 300,000 words might be time-consuming for ordinary people, depending on their reading speed and purpose. If you read fast every day and only skimmed through it, it might take you a few days to finish a book. If you read slowly and studied each chapter carefully, it might take weeks or even months to finish. The length and content of the other book would also affect the reading time. If it was a short story or an easy-to-understand novel, it might only take a few days to finish reading it. Some more professional or complicated novels might take longer or even months to finish.

How long will it take to finish reading chapter 150?

This depended on the length of each chapter and the reading speed. If each chapter had an average of 5000 words and the reading speed was around 400 words per minute, then a 150-chapter novel would take at least 13 hours. However, this would depend on the reading habits and the time available. How long will it take to finish reading a novel of 60,000 words?

A normal person's reading speed was 200 - 500 words per minute. For a 60,000-word novel, if it was read at a slower speed of 200 words per minute, it would take about five hours. If it was read at a faster speed of 500 words per minute, it would take about two hours. However, this was only a rough estimate. The actual reading time varied from person to person. <a href="/?from=ask_words" style="color:red" target="_blank">Read more exciting novels for free</a>
